Output 51e69e3f0b425b4f20a459832fbbdc10d55ac7ce80218b4874de69662ad01ba4:4

value
790396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f81cd287d482955519e6375892e964850aec819 OP_EQUAL
address
3K9cUwdRywHo37sahvzyhmztRZ7H9YV4CS
transaction
51e69e3f0b425b4f20a459832fbbdc10d55ac7ce80218b4874de69662ad01ba4
spent
true